Useful Pitching Statistics
The Mets have a 26-27 overall record this season. Starting pitcher Noah Syndergaard has a 3-4 record with an earned run average of 4.93 and a WHIP of 1.26 this season. He has 72 strikeouts over his 69.1 innings pitched and he's given up 72 hits. He's allowed 9.3 hits per 9 innings and he has a FIP of 3.69. The bullpen has an earned run average of 4.65 and they have given up 177 base hits on the year. Teams are hitting .245 against the bullpen and they've struck out 193 hitters and walked 87 batters. As a team, New York allows 8.8 hits per nine innings while striking out 9.3 batters per nine innings. They are 18th in the league in team earned run average at 4.52. The Mets pitchers collectively have given up 467 base hits and 239 earned runs. They have allowed 65 home runs this season, ranking them 22nd in the league. New York as a pitching staff has walked 182 batters and struck out 493. They have walked 3.4 men per 9 innings while striking out 9.3 per 9. They have a team WHIP of 1.36 and their FIP as a unit is 4.10.
Hitting Statistics
As a team New York is hitting .246, good for 20th in the league. The Mets hold a .411 team slugging percentage and an on-base percentage of .323, which is good for 15th in baseball. They rank 17th in MLB with 8.5 hits per game. Amed Rosario is hitting .256 with an on-base percentage of .299. He has 51 hits this season in 199 at bats with 27 runs batted in. He has a slugging percentage of .407 and an OPS+ of 93. Pete Alonso is hitting .254 this year and he has an on-base percentage of .332. He has totaled 48 hits and he has driven in 39 men in 189 at bats. His OPS+ is 148 while his slugging percentage is at .593. The Mets have 449 hits, including 87 doubles and 67 home runs. New York has walked 182 times so far this season and they have struck out 502 times as a unit. They have left 375 men on base and have a team OPS of .734. They score 4.6 runs per contest and have scored a total of 244 runs this year.
Useful Pitching Statistics
Los Angeles has a 36-18 overall mark this year. With an earned run average of 3.58, Walker Buehler has a 5-1 record and a 1.05 WHIP. He has 52 strikeouts over the 55.1 innings he's pitched. He also has given up 47 hits. He's allowing 7.6 hits per nine innings and his FIP stands at 3.06. The bullpen has an earned run average of 4.63 and they have given up 154 base hits on the year. Teams are hitting .237 against the Dodgers bullpen. Their relievers have struck out 162 batters and walked 51 opposing hitters. As a team, Los Angeles allows 7.8 hits per nine innings while striking out 8.8 batters per nine innings. They are 3rd in the league in team earned run average at 3.51. The Dodgers pitchers as a team have surrendered 413 base knocks and 187 earned runs this season. They have given up 64 home runs this year, which ranks 24th in Major League Baseball. Los Angeles as a staff has walked 119 hitters and struck out 468 batters. They give up a walk 2.2 times per 9 innings while they strike out 8.8 per 9. Their team WHIP is 1.11 while their FIP as a staff is 3.77.
Hitting Statistics
As a team, they are batting .261, good for 3rd in the league. The Dodgers hold a .460 team slugging percentage and an on-base percentage of .349, which is good for 2nd in baseball. They rank 9th in MLB with 8.7 hits per contest. Cody Bellinger comes into this matchup batting .383 with an OBP of .469. He has 72 hits this year along with 49 RBI in 188 AB's. He maintains a slugging percentage of .761 with an OPS+ of 222. Justin Turner is hitting .307 this season and he has an OBP of .396. He has collected 54 hits in 176 at bats while driving in 23 runs. He has an OPS+ of 127 and a slugging percentage of .449. The Dodgers as a unit have 472 base hits, including 86 doubles and 84 homers. Los Angeles has walked 224 times this year and they have struck out on 413 occasions. They have had 401 men left on base and have an OPS of .809. They have scored 5.44 runs per game and totaled 294 runs this season.
